What’s the Dear John movie about?
John Tyree (Channing Tatum from Step Up and The Eagle), an American Special Forces soldier, takes advantage of a leave in the USA to see his father and go surfing. Savannah Curtis (Amanda Seyfried from Solstice and Mamma Mia!) is a student and they meet by chance on the beach. It's love at first sight between them, and although they belong to two different worlds, an absolute passion brings them together for two weeks. But John has to leave again and, following the September 11 attacks, he is sent to Afghanistan. As for Savannah, she must return to the University. For several months, John and Savannah write heated letters to each other. Savannah, more and more worried about the safety of her beloved, questions herself. As desires and responsibilities become more and more opposed, the couple struggles to maintain their commitments. Then, at the worst possible moment, John receives a letter of rupture without any other explanation. He is destroyed and does not understand what is happening to him. When he returns to America for his father's funeral, he sees Savannah again. This one got married. The young girl has not given in to a whim or to her family's orders: if, in John's absence, she has chosen to marry Tim (Henry Thomas from E.T.), whom she has known since childhood, it is because he is suffering from cancer and someone has to take care of his son Alan, an endearing child who is also autistic. Even though the end credits come before the denouement, we understand that after Tim's death, John and Savannah will be able to love each other and raise Alan together, respecting the memory of his father.
